Management of hyperkalaemia in the Italian clinical practice: impact of diverse potassium binders on outcomes and costs in patients with chronic kidney disease and heart failure
Introduction Hyperkalemia is a common and clinically relevant condition in patients with chronic kidney disease (CKD)
and heart failure (HF), often limiting optimal use of renin–angiotensin–aldosterone system inhibitors (RAASi).
Methods This real-world study evaluated adherence, clinical outcomes, and healthcare costs among Italian patients initiating
patiromer, sodium zirconium cyclosilicate (SZC), or sodium polystyrene sulfonate (SPS) between January 2022 and
June 2024.
Results Administrative data covering about 10% of the Italian population identified 1953 patients: 249 on patiromer, 387 on
SZC, and 1317 on SPS. After full matching, 67.5% of patiromer patients were adherent at 6 months, compared with 20.4%
for SZC and 0.5% for SPS (p < 0.001). Over the total follow-up, adherence remained higher with patiromer (42.5% vs 13.4%
and 0.5%). During the first 6 months, HF-related hospitalization rates were lower with patiromer versus SZC (5.4 vs 12.8
events per 100 person-years; p = 0.079), becoming significant over overall follow-up (5.3 vs 15.7; p = 0.003). Composite
HF outcomes at 6 months were also lower with patiromer compared with SZC (5.3 vs 17.4; p = 0.012) and SPS (3.4 vs 24.8;
p = 0.005). At 12 months, total healthcare costs were significantly lower with patiromer than with SZC and SPS (€5645 vs
€8500 and €4736 vs €6234; p < 0.001). Overall, patiromer use was associated with better adherence, fewer HF-related events,
and reduced healthcare expenditure.
Conclusions These findings suggest a patiromer potential role for sustained potassium binder therapy in supporting RAASi
optimization and improving clinical management in routine practice, but confirmation through direct comparative prospective
randomized trials is needed
